Bennett Fisher is a San Francisco based playwright, director, and actor. He has performed with San Francisco Theater Pub (Henry IV Parts I and II), Marin Shakespeare Company (Antony and Cleopatra), Crowded Fire (The Lysistrata Project), the Pear Ave Theatre (Pick Up Ax), Stanford Summer Theater (Elektra), AtmosTheatre (The Frogs), and Brava Women’s Theatre (Sincerity Forever), among others. Directing credits include Audience and Ubu Roi for San Francisco Theater Pub and the upcoming world-premiere of Susan Sobeloff’s Merchants for No Nude Men. His first full length play, Hermes, premièred in San Francisco last fall, where it was hailed as a “daring and extremely intelligent” and “a breathtaking experience in relevant, contemporary theatre” by The Huffington Post. Two more of his full-length plays – Devil of a Time and Don’t Be Evil – are slated for full production in 2011-2012. His various short plays have been performed in New York, Boston, San Francisco, Chicago, and New London. He is an associate artist with AtmosTheatre and Threshold Theatre, a founding director of the San Francisco Theater Pub, and the artistic director of the Flying Island Theatre Lab, in residence at the Palo Alto Art Center.
